How do you set a starting lineup for a Formula 1 race?In order to set the starting lineup for the race, each driver must qualify — or, set the fastest lap possible compared to the competition. Qualifying position often translates to race finish; the higher you qualify, the more likely you are to finish better in the race. Formula 1 qualifying takes place in three sessions, known as Q1, Q2, and Q3.How are Formula 1 races started?Lights Out: Formula 1 races are started via an automated light system. Five red lights will blink on in slow succession; when all five lights go black, that indicates the start of a race!
